Basic Strategies For First Time Investors

August 6th, 2009

The way you buy stocks has changed a lot in the last 10 years. It used to be that you had to find and contact a broker, probably go into their office in your city, open an account, and then arrange to have funds transferred. Every time you wanted to buy or sell a stock, you had to pick up the phone and tell you broker what you wanted to have done. Actually meeting up with someone and having to call them to make trades might have been a bit intimidating for a beginner.

Now with the Internet however, how to buy stocks for beginners has gotten extremely easy. Everything can be done through the computer and you most likely will never have to speak to anyone. You can choose a brokerage and open up an account online, send in the money via snail mail or wire transfer, and then make trades all day long by just pushing buttons on your computer. No human contact is ever necessary which makes it less intimidating for someone who is new to investing to get started.

Where can a novice investor go to learn how to buy stocks and how the market works? There are many books in the library that will explain all the terms and principles and you can also do a lot of research online. Watching investment television programs would probably not be a great idea because all those “gurus” seem to want to do is give you their stock picks that are dubious at best.

Once you have studied some stock market basics for a while, it could be a good time to get started buying a stock. You can read and learn all you want but nothing is a substitute for the real thing. On the job learning is the best teacher and that goes for the stock market too.

Although the market is down right now and it is usually best to buy stocks when they are low, you still might not want to jump in just yet. The economy is worse off than at any time in recent memory and it could be headed back down even further. In this kind of a bear market, things are so bad that all stocks will go down even if they are of companies that are doing well. It might be best to hold on and wait things out a little while until the picture becomes clearer and things start to turn around in earnest. It is best to be cautious in this kind of a bear market, especially if you are a beginner.

Trade Smart With Mini Forex Trading

August 5th, 2009

Trading in an investment market such as Forex takes much time and effort compared to other investment trading markets. So, why is Forex not losing popularity and having a shortage of new investors? Well, simply for the simple reason that its an investment market that it presents anyone the chance to make large profits in only a short a time, while incurring minimal costs - considering if they play their cards right, that is.

Mini-Forex trading market is very profitable way of trading since the lot size of a mini account is just one-tenth of a standard accounts lot size, so it gives the trader the chance to trade with lesser amounts with just a small initial capital fund, while controlling a larger currency position. An example would be if a $100,000 position is held in a 100:1 margin, the trader has only to put up $1,000, or 1% to control the position. In futures trading its about 5% of the total value of the holding, and about 25% for equities.

Although this type of trading is very profitable, it involves more risks if one does fully understand what is involved and at stake. Every trader has to have a clear understanding how their margin account works in relation to the margin agreement with their respective clearing firm. If you don’t have a clear understanding or comprehension of how it works, it’s best to consult with the account manager immediately.

The positions of any trader with regard to their accounts are subject to full or partial liquidation should this fall below the specified allowable amounts. At times, this can be liquidated even before you get any margin call. Some employ automatic systems to close out positions when the trader runs out of capital. Be on the alert at all times by regularly monitoring your balance, and utilize your stop-loss orders when the market is on the downtrend to risk losing big time.

Compared to futures and equities trade markets, Forex currency trading has the advantage of not having any commissions, exchange, and brokerage fees. Without such payments to contend with, traders have larger spreads, thus are able to have increased profits with each successful trade deal. And since it has no central controlling point, trading happens in a 24 hour basis with a continuous stream of buyers and sellers from all corners of the world.

Mini Forex trading offers a better option from futures and commodities trading. As certainly with its existing risks, having a good understanding, backed by a dependable trading system, any one can become a successful and profitable trader in a market that is vibrant and volatile to a fault ” mini Forex trading or not.

Good Sign for Kamloops Real Estate Market

July 27th, 2009

As you all know, 2008 was easily one of the most brutal real estate years we have had in the last 25 years. With that said, Kamloops real estate experts are comparing our current situation with the market crash of the 80s.

House owners are going to happy to hear that prices should start to rise again by the end of 2009, something they thought they’d never hear. In order for the market the rise again it will have to hit an ultimate low which experts say is right around the corner.

Knowing how the crash originally crashed is the only way you will be able to comprehend how there will ever be a rise again. Different components can easily be fingered as the market down fall. In 2000 the housing market starting a price rise that would last until 2006, in this time most communities would see their property price double.

As prices were rising at amazing rates, potential buyers acknowledged that they weren’t making enough money to purchase a home. There started to be a lot of houses on the market but no suitable buyers, this meant values had to come down in order for people to be interested in them.

The market shift can also be attributed to the sub prime mortgages, I’m sure you saw this through the many newspapers and magazines. This came about mainly by our friend south of the border, the USA. Our communities were definitely still affected by this situation.

Inadequate buyers were applying for loans that were out of their reach, but that didn’t stop lending officers from approving many of these buyers with little down payments. Those buyers who bought right before the crash found themselves in houses that were worth less then the mortgages.

Once the unqualified owners started falling behind on payments they started getting pressure from the banks. In no time foreclosures were happening everywhere. As more and more foreclosures kept happening, the properties began to change course. There began to be more houses on the market then there were buyers which starts to send the prices straight down.

Unfortunately, Canada and the Kamloops real estate market is directly affected buy those happenings in the USA. Now that their market is near its bottom, we will start to see some change in our real estate market.

Also realize to that if you were to look today, most big city centers are seeing property prices increase, this means that it cant be far away for people located in the suburbs and smaller cities. Since house prices have come down, there are now more people that can afford them. This means that Kamloops real estate along with the rest of Canada is should start to see good things happen.

Tips For Buying Your First Home

June 26th, 2009

Have you decided to purchase your first home? It’s a very exciting time and can be a tad bit confusing because there are so many things to consider. Preparing yourself with the information that will make the process as smooth as possible is the important first step. Truth be told, if you’re a first time home buyer, it can be very confusing to figure out which aspect of it to tackle first.

Many people tend to buy a home simply because they have fallen in love with the way it looks, its layout and the neighborhood that it’s in. But that is the wrong way to do it. Sure, appearance and location are important as well but there are plenty more things to consider before you make your final choice. Here are a few tips to help you get started:

First, think about your finances. These days and due to the current state of the economy, very few people can actually afford buying a home outright. Unless you have inherited a huge sum of money, this can be quite impossible. So think about getting a mortgage. It sounds a little daunting but if you choose the right people to borrow from and get your finances straight, it should be no problem at all.

Now, let’s talk about mortgage. The amount that your mortgage lender would be willing to lend you totally depends upon your current income, the debts that you have, as well as your savings. Thus it’s important to figure out a budget before you even go home hunting. Doing things that way would make it easier for you to find homes within your price range and avoid spending too much.

Once you have all of that sorted out, its time to actually look for a home. Where do you begin? You can try your local real estate agents, in the newspaper, as well as through the Internet. All of these would provide you with enough options when it comes to houses within your price range.

After you’ve found a home that fits your budget perfectly as well as your aesthetic preferences, it’s now time to make an offer on said house. Your solicitor can do this for you, however if you’re buying a house directly from the owner then this would allow you to make an informal offer to your seller.

So you and your seller have reached an agreement, now it’s time to get things on paper, which means getting an official deed of sale. This would state just how much you’ll have to pay to buy the house, all the things included in the sale (such as furnishings, outbuildings etc.) and the date when you can move in.

The process is time consuming and somewhat complicated but within the reach of anyone. Buying your first home is daunting and there’s no doubt about that. But you needn’t be scared because as long as you know and understand everything that comes with buying a home, everything would be just fine. Happy house hunting!
